Wise Mind: Logic Meets Emotion

Breathe ten times and find the point between your emotional and logical minds.

7 min Beginner

Goal

Build the ability to respond from the intersection of emotion and logic (Wise Mind) rather than either alone.

Evidence base

School: DBT

Founders: Marsha M. Linehan (1993)

Wise Mind concept inspired by Zen meditation. It's your "full epistemic self" per Linehan.
